Brian Meehan has never been scared to take on the big boys at their own game and they come no bigger at the latest stage of the Meydan Carnival on Thursday.
Meehan is a top - but often under-rated – trainer, and if he's ready to send two to contest the UAE 2000 Guineas then it's more than worth taking a careful look to his contenders.

Godolphin's Rassam is set to go off as a short priced favourite in the capable hands of a certain Frankie Dettori, but Meehan is a class act and is not a trainer to travel thousands of miles in pursuit on a wing and prayer.
Mehdi - ridden by Kieren Fallon - looks to have a real chance and can be backed at 15.00, with his trainer declaring: "He ran a promising fourth in the trial here a fortnight ago in a very tight battle for places after a long break from his final start in 2011.
"He has a fighting chance of pegging back the three who finished in front of him and to be honest has a lot going for him."
Meehan's other runner Burano, who is at 11.00, and is more than capable of making an impact on this affair because, although still a maiden, he has tackled particularly strong animals during his juvenile campaign.
